The Octopus Project release third single off latest album Fever Forms

The Octopus Project - Fever Forms

Hot on the heels of their recently released fifth album, Fever Forms, Austin based experimental pop quartet The Octopus Project have dropped the third single ‘Perhap’.
With Fever Forms, which was recorded by themselves and co-mixed with Erik Wofford (Maserati, Black Angels, M. Ward), the band mirrors their distinct energetic and intense live performances more than in previous albums. As the press release notes, the new album “is most representative of the Octopus Project live experience – dense and euphoric, a concentrated dose of frenetic beats and exuberant melody set in a brilliantly colored sound world”.

Inga Copeland becomes copeland and drops new single

copeland

Inga Copeland is probably best known as one half of Hype Williams alongside Dean Blunt. The pair announced recently their dissociation and they might not be making music together anymore, but we’ll be listening to their productions in a solo format. Blunt recently released a mixtape, and now a new single from Copeland called ‘Fit’ has emerged via her youtube channel simply under the moniker copeland. Listen to it now.

Zammuto releases third and final track ahead of new album

Zammuto

Zammuto‘s second album is in the works and the foursome led by Nick Zammuto launched last month a campaign to help fund the yet-to be-titled album. Over the duration of the campaign, which ends today, Zammuto promised to share three tracks from the upcoming album. We already heard the excellent ‘Sinker‘ and the funky as hell ‘Need More Sun’ and the third and final track is now streaming for our listening pleasure. Listen to ‘Corduroy’ below.

Sam Shalabi’s Land of Kush announce release of new album The Big Mango

Land of Kush - The Big Mango

Land Of Kush, the large orchestral ensemble recruited and directed by prolific Montreal composer and musician Sam Shalabi, will release a new album this Autumn. The Big Mango, due out on October 1st via Constellation, is inspired by and dedicated to the city of Cairo where Shalabi has been residing since 2011. In Shalabi’s own words, The Big Mango is “a love letter to Cairo” framed by “the beautiful, surreal madness of the city…as joyous, horrific, historical events were unfolding”.
